>> I have not been able to get alsasound working on my gentoo-gnome
>> system.
>>
>> I followed the gentoo guide and did make progress.
>> From the main (foot) menu,  system --> preference --> sound
>> produces a dialog box with three tabs.
>>
>> The first tab is devices.  They are all set to autodetect and when I
>> press test on the three playback devices, I do hear sound.
>>
>> The second tab is sounds.  When I click on any of the "Play" boxes
>> *no* sound is produced.  The corresponding files are present and I
>> am in the audio group.
>>
>> The machine is a dell optiplex 845.  Lspci shows
>>   00:1b.0 Audio device: Intel Corporation 82801H (ICH8 Family)
>>   HD Audio Controller (rev 02)
>>
>> I have the following kernel options set
>>
>> #
>> # Sound
>> #
>> CONFIG_SOUND=m
>>
>> #
>> # Advanced Linux Sound Architecture
>> #
>> CONFIG_SND=m
>> CONFIG_SND_TIMER=m
>> CONFIG_SND_PCM=m
>> CONFIG_SND_HWDEP=m
>> CONFIG_SND_SEQUENCER=m
>> CONFIG_SND_OSSEMUL=y
>> CONFIG_SND_MIXER_OSS=m
>> CONFIG_SND_PCM_OSS=m
>>
>> #
>> # PCI devices
>> #
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_INTEL=m
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_HWDEP=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_REALTEK=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_ANALOG=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_SIGMATEL=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_VIA=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_ATIHDMI=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_CONEXANT=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_CMEDIA=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_CODEC_SI3054=y
>> CONFIG_SND_HDA_GENERIC=y
>>
>> Any advice/help would be appreciated
>> thanks,
>> allan
